Ah, I see I forgot to checkin a fix for building on Linux. There's a linker setting in most CMakeLists.txt files that should be if(APPLE). If you actually wanted to try building on a Mac that will probably need some hand holding also, but shouldn't be too hard. I used http://brew.sh/ to get all dependencies except Qt. The old mac I had available can hardly cope with all this ;) I'm pretty annoyed with the Mac way of things also, this was with a MacBook 2,1 from 2007, it's no longer supported by current OS and subsequently third party softwares are moving to the unsupported category. I had to look for quite a while before I found the few prebuilt Qt sdk that was possible to install.
